Fashion Forward: Unveiling a Most Iconic Trends
From the audacious bootcuts of the 70s to those minimalist chic of the 90s, fashion has continually been a stage for self-expression. Particular trends transcend time, becoming classics in the ever-evolving world of style.
- Let's delve into the few defining fashion trends that have left an unforgettable mark on history.
Embracing the spirit of rebellion, punk fashion in the late 70s and early 80s wore safety pins, ripped denim, and bold prints.
- This era promoted individuality and rejected societal norms.
On the other hand, the 90s witnessed the rise of minimalism, with sleek styles and neutral tones.
- Imagine slip dresses, oversized sweaters, and simple designs.
